S. 610 (99th)
A bill to amend section 1030 of title 18, United States Code, to clarify coverage with respect to access to computers operated for or on behalf of the Federal Government.

Summary
Amends the Federal criminal code to make it a Federal offense to knowingly access a U.S. Government computer without authorization or with authorization for unauthorized purposes and by such conduct use or disclose individually identifiable information which is protected by the Privacy Act.
